CI&T names new Australian product director

Global digital transformation specialist CI&T has appointed Katherine Wolfe as its new Australian product director to lead product management and innovation initiatives.
Wolfe brings 15 years of leadership experience from roles at major Australian companies including Telstra, NAB and ANZ.
She takes responsibility for leading CI&T's product management team and driving user experience capabilities.
Wolfe will focus on integrating customer experience into product design and development processes.
Her experience spans digital transformation and product development across financial services, health, government and not-for-profit sectors.
"I am excited about the opportunity to join CI&T, given its extensive reach and influence both in Australia and globally," Katherine Wolfe said.
The appointment aims to enhance CI&T's product-centric innovation approach for its more than 100 enterprise clients.
CI&T has offices in Brisbane and Melbourne, with nearly 30 staff in Australia and first entered the local market in 2020.
The NYSE-listed company has existed for nearly 30 years, focusing on digital transformation, data, cloud, application modernisation and generative artificial intelligence (GenAI).
Locally, CI&T counts Virgin Australia, Vodafone and Flight Centre as customers.
CI&T partner with Amazon Web Services and Databricks to deliver digital solutions, and utlises its own GenAI.
